    About Lizette

    Lizette offers a lovely blend of classic roots and a contemporary feel, perfect for parents who appreciate elegance with a touch of Continental flair. This name, ultimately meaning "pledged to God," carries a sophisticated air, echoing its French and Hebrew heritage. While it shares its core meaning with the ever-popular Elizabeth, Lizette distinguishes itself with a lighter, more rhythmic sound that feels fresh and less formal. It's a choice that speaks to a refined taste, offering a distinctive alternative to its more common cousins while retaining a sense of timeless grace.
